N2 - This disc is one of eleven recordings made by Claudio Ronco and Emanuela Vozza through which they showcase the music of virtuosic cellist-composers from the mid-eighteenth to early nineteenth centuries. An overlooked repertory and – performed by a cello duo rather than a solo cellist with keyboard accompaniment – a neglected mode of performance, this series frequently includes works new to disc. The four sonatas performed here, from Jean-Louis Duport's Op. 4, have not previously been recorded, whilst the two earlier duos are presented on period instruments for the first time.
